FYC
Natalie Portman, Best Supporting Actress, Entertainer of the Year
Garden State
"...find the love of his life in a sweet-crazy-sexy, Shins-loving pathological liar named Sam, played by Natalie Portman in a funny and touching performance you shouldn't even try to resist."-Peter Travers, Rolling Stone
"This film showcases another excellent performance by Natalie Portman, a great comic bookend to her great dramatic performance in 'Closer.'"-Robert Roten, Laramie Movie Scope
Closer
"Portman, well, she shines. It's a performance that really does mark her entrance into movie adulthood."-Stephen Rea, Philadelphia Inquirer
"The fact that Ms. Portman's Alice most openly shows her wounds makes the audience feel "safe" in empathizing with her. But the gifted young actress presents a multifaceted portrayal of a hard-edged, hard-living woman."-Philip Wuntch, The Dallas Morning News
"But the real standout is Portman, whose performances continue to get stronger and more mature."-Jeff Vice, Desert Morning News
"Portman almost steals the show. She would have, if Alice were in more scenes and if the screenwriter understood her better. In a sense, Alice is a sketch of a character, but Portman fills her out with her live, intelligent eyes and with a smile that suggests more than mischief, maybe trouble. Portman also goes beyond charm in an excruciating break-up scene, and she carries off a potentially embarrassing strip club scene with admirable self-possession. In their scenes together, she matches Owen, tops him, and makes him top himself."-Mick LaSalle, The San Fransisco Chronicle
